在疏浚过程中泥泵内产生的气体大大降低了泥泵的效率。文章分析了泥泵内的气体是怎样产生的;而气体又是如何使工作效率降低的;怎样将泥泵内的气体排除。并详细介绍了"万倾沙"泥泵系统的组成及工作原理。结果表明:泥泵除气系统在理论上和实际使用中都能够提高疏浚效率。 相似文献

为了解决喷水推进船在各种工况下,喷泵工作在气蚀区的问题,利用Simulink与MFC(Microsoft Foundation Class)集成的方法开发出了可用于制定喷水推进装置在回转、加速等工况下,避免喷泵在空化区运行的工作制的仿真程序.利用开发出的仿真程序对特定工况下的最大柴油机转速、最大喷泵转角以及最短加速时间做了仿真计算.该计算结果对喷水推进艇避免喷泵气蚀的操作规程有一定的参考价值. 相似文献

Parallel turbine-driven feedwater pumps are needed when ships travel at high speed. In order to study marine steam generator feedwater control systems which use parallel turbine-driven feed pumps, a mathematical model of marine steam generator feedwater control system was developed which includes mathematical models of two steam generators and parallel turbine-driven feed pumps as well as mathematical models of feedwater pipes and feed regulating valves. The operating condition points of the parallel ttu-bine-driven feed pumps were calculated by the Chebyshev curve fit method. A water level controller for the steam generator and a rotary speed controller for the turbine-driven feed pumps were also included in the model. The accuracy of the mathematical models and their controllers was verified by comparing their results with those from a simulator. 相似文献
